A DYNAMICAL PROFILE OF METAL INCORPORATION TO A LIPOSOMAL MEMBRANE AS STUDIED BY ELECTRON SPIN RESONANCE

1984 
An Egg-Yolk lecithin liposome containing the surfacant cyclic polyamine was prepared, and a dynamical behavior of its Cu(II) ion uptake was studied by monitoring a time dependent decay of the isotropic copper nucleus hyperfine splitting in the ESR upon metal incorporation into a liposomal membrane. The reaction kinetics studied by ESR justified the fact that there are the two kinds of metal binding processes, in which the distinctive time course and the activation energy can be clearly demonstrated.
